Two boys are being praised after they were caught on camera stopping their bikes to honor a nearby funeral procession for a fallen veteran.
Jacqi Hornbach happened to be outside “enjoying the nice weather,” when she noticed the two boys riding around on their bikes.
She shared on Facebook that there was a funeral for a fallen veteran happening at a cemetery across the street from her near where the boys were riding.
As soon as the boys noticed the flag of the deceased veteran, they “immediately stopped riding, got off their bikes, and stood with respect as TAPS was being played.”
Naturally, Jacqi had to snap a photo of the sweet moment and share it with the world:

In the comments of her post, many people praised the boys and their parents for their level of respect.
It wasn’t long until the photos went viral as people from around the world were taken aback by the thoughtful actions of the young boys.

Some assumed the boys had been raised on a military base and that’s how they knew to pay their respects to the funeral procession, but Jacqi noted in the comments of her post that neither boy lived on base or had military parents.
